> +
> + if (IS_DAX(inode1) && IS_DAX(inode2))
> + ret = xfs_break_two_dax_layouts(inode1, inode2);

This is wrong on many levels.

The first problem is that xfs_break_two_dax_layouts calls
xfs_break_dax_layouts twice even if inode1 == inode2, which is
unnecessary.

The second problem is that xfs_break_dax_layouts can cycle the MMAPLOCK
on the inode that it's processing. Since there are two inodes in play
here, you must be /very/ careful about maintaining correct locking order,
which for the MMAPLOCK is increasing order of xfs_inode.i_ino. If you
drop the MMAPLOCK for the lower-numbered inode for any reason, you have
to drop both MMAPLOCKs and try again.

In other words, you have to replace all that nice MMAPLOCK code with a
new xfs_mmaplock_two_inodes_and_break_dax_layouts function that is
structured similarly to what xfs_iolock_two_inodes_and_break_layout
does for the IOLOCK and PNFS layouts.
